The strut height is set laying the rigger on a flat surface....with the sponsons resting on a flat surface, raise the transom of the boat until the bottom of the hull is PARALLEL to your flat surface....that is where the bottom of the strut needs to be....basically the depth of your sponsons...Hey Hotwater, or anyone else who have made one, can you do me a favour? Also, when you setup your turn fin, the horizontal bend in the fin (when looking at it from the side) also needs to be parallel to the bottom of the tub.....Last edited by HOTWATER; 06-16-2011, 12:33 AM.Comment
